< Jeremia 1 >
1 Weche Jeremia wuod Hilkia, achiel kuom jodolo man Anathoth e piny Benjamin.
The words of Jeremiah son of Hilkiah, —of the priests who were in Anathoth, in the land of Benjamin:
2 Wach Jehova Nyasaye nobirone e higa mar apar gadek e loch Josia wuod Amon ruodh Juda,
unto whom came the word of Yahweh, in the days of Josiah son of Amon king of Judah, —in the thirteenth year of his reign;
3 kendo kokalo e loch Jehoyakim wuod Josia ruodh Juda, kodhi nyaka e dwe mar abich mar higa mar apar gachiel mar Zedekia wuod Josia ruodh Juda, sa mane joma odak Jerusalem dhi e twech.
it came also in the days of Jehoiakim son of Josiah, king of Judah, unto the end of the eleventh year of Zedekiah son of Josiah king of Judah, —as far as the carrying away of Jerusalem captive, in the fifth month.
4 Wach Jehova Nyasaye nobirona, kawacho niya,
So then, the word of Yahweh came unto me, saying:
5 “Kane pok achweyi e ich ne angʼeyi, kane pok onywoli ne asewali tenge; ne ayieri kaka janabi ne pinje.”
Before I formed thee at thy birth, I took knowledge of thee, And before thy nativity, I hallowed thee, —A prophet to the nations, I appointed thee.
6 Ne awacho niya, “Yaye, Jehova Nyasaye Manyalo Gik Moko Duto, ok angʼeyo wuoyo; an mana rawera matin.”
Then said I—Ah! My Lord Yahweh! Lo! I know not how to speak, —For a child, am I!
7 To Jehova Nyasaye nowachona niya, “Kik iwach ni, ‘An mana nyathi.’ Nyaka idhi ir ji duto maori irgi kendo iwach gimoro amora ma achiki.
Then said Yahweh unto me, Do not say, A child, am, I,—For against whomsoever I send thee, shalt thou go, And whatsoever I command thee, shalt thou speak:
8 Kik iluorgi, nimar an kodi kendo abiro resoi,” Jehova Nyasaye owacho.
Be not afraid of their faces, For with thee, am I, to deliver thee Declareth Yahweh.
9 Eka Jehova Nyasaye norieyo bade kendo omulo dhoga mi owachona niya, “Koro, aseketo wechega e dhogi.
Then Yahweh put forth his hand, and touched my mouth, —and Yahweh said unto me, Lo! I have put my words in thy mouth.
10 Ne, kawuononi ayieri ewi ogendini kod pinjeruodhi mondo ipudhi kendo iyiechi, mondo ikethi kendo ilok loch, mondo iger kendo ipudhi.”
See! I have set thee in charge this day, over the nations and over the kingdoms, To uproot and to break down, and to destroy and to tear in pieces, —To build and to plant.
11 Wach Jehova Nyasaye nobirona niya: “En angʼo mineno, Jeremia?” Anto ne adwoke ni, “Aneno bad yath mar oyungu.”
Moreover the Word of Yahweh came unto me saying, What canst thou see Jeremiah? And I said, A twig of an almond-tree, can I see.
12 Jehova Nyasaye nowachona niya, “Ineno kare, nimar arito mondo ane ni wachna ochopo kare.”
Then said Yahweh unto me—Thou hast rightly seen, —for keeping watch, am I over my word to perform it.
13 Wach Jehova Nyasaye nochako birona kendo kopenjo niya, “En angʼo mineno?” Anto ne adwoke niya, “Aneno agulu mayienyo, kolokore oa yo nyandwat.”
And the word of Yahweh came unto me a second time saying, What canst thou see? And I said, A boiling caldron, can I see, with, the front thereof, on the North.
14 Jehova Nyasaye nowachona, “Koa yo nyandwat masira ibiro ol kuom jogo duto modak e piny.
Then said Yahweh unto me, —Out of the North, shall break forth calamity, against all the inhabitants of the land.
15 Achiegni luongo ji duto mag pinje ma yo nyandwat,” Jehova Nyasaye wacho. Ruodhigi biro biro kendo giniket kom duongʼ-gi e kar donjo mar dhorangeye Jerusalem; gibiro monjo ohingini duto molwore kendo monjo mier madongo duto mag Juda.
For behold me! calling for all the families of the kingdoms of the North, Declareth Yahweh, —and they shall come, and set every one his throne at the opening of the gates of Jerusalem and against all her walls round about, and against all the cities of Judah!
16 Abiro ngʼadone joga bura nikech timbegi mamono mar jwangʼa, kuom wangʼo ubani ne nyiseche mamoko kendo lamo gima lwetgi oseloso.
Then will I pronounce my judgments against them, concerning all their wickedness, —in that they have forsaken me and have burned incense unto other gods, and have bowed down to the works of their own hands,
17 “Bed moikore! Chungʼ malo kendo wachnegi gimoro amora machiki. Kik iwe gibwogi, ka ok kamano to abiro bwogi e nyimgi.
Thou, therefore, shalt gird thy loins, and arise, and speak unto them, all that, I, command thee, —be not dismayed because of them, lest I dismay thee before their face.
18 Kawuono aseketi dala maduongʼ mochiel motegno, kendo gi siro mar chuma kod ohinga mar mula mondo ogengʼne piny ngima, ma gin ruodhi mag Juda, jotende, jodolo mage kod ji duto mag pinyno.
I, therefore—lo! I have set thee to-day as a fortified city, and as a pillar of iron and as walls of bronze, over all the land, —against the kings of Judah, against her princes, against her priests and against the people of the land.
19 Gibiro kedo kodi to ok gini loyi, nimar an kodi kendo abiro resi,” Jehova Nyasaye owacho.
And they will fight against thee but shall not prevail against thee, —for with thee, am I, Declareth Yahweh, to deliver thee.
